Malayalam cinema, also known as Mollywood, is a thriving film industry based in Kerala, India. While it has produced many critically acclaimed and commercially successful films, it also has a segment of B-grade movies that cater to a specific audience.

Shakeela’s films were almost exclusively stamped as "Grade" movies. But here is the critical irony: While the elite sneered at the "Grade" tag, Shakeela’s films funded more small-time producers and employed more junior artists, light boys, and makeup men than many "parallel cinema" sets combined. Her independence was financial, not artistic. She didn’t need government grants or corporate studios; she had a direct pipeline to an audience that the mainstream refused to see.
